Shirley Train Station offers a range of essential facilities to make your journey comfortable. The ticket office is open from Monday to Friday, 6:30 am to 12:00 pm, with extended hours until 8:00 pm on Fridays and Saturdays. While ticket machines are available for ease, the station lacks accessible ticket machines. However, rest assured you can collect tickets conveniently from the office.
Accessible features at Shirley include step-free access to all platforms, making it a category A station for accessibility. Though there are no waiting rooms, there is a seating area and available toilets on Platform 1. These include accessible toilets operated by a RADAR key, obtainable from station staff during their hours.
Travelling beyond Shirley is simple with several onward travel options. Should rail replacement services be necessary, they depart from the station entrance. For those preferring taxis, local services like Shirley (SRL) Station A to B, Senator, and Able are available for hire. Additionally, the station is well-connected by buses, allowing easy exploration of the surrounding area.

At Egham Station, ticket purchases and collections are hassle-free. The ticket office is open from 06:15 to 19:55 on weekdays and Saturdays, and slightly adjusted hours on Sundays. You’ll also find ticket machines available for use, all accessible and compatible with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. If you're thinking about smart travel solutions, rest assured, smartcards can be issued and validated right here.
Accessibility is a priority at Egham. Although the station presents a few challenges regarding step-free access, both platforms are designed to accommodate various needs through strategic planning. Regular updates ensure travelers are well-informed, thanks to customer information screens. For those traveling by car, there’s parking available with 54 spaces including three designated for accessible parking.
When it comes to passenger comfort, Egham features sheltered seating areas on both platforms. Although there's no dedicated waiting room, these areas offer a place to rest while waiting for your train. Essential facilities like accessible toilets and an ATM are available, alongside refreshment facilities to keep you energized.
Egham Station's excellent transport links make it an essential node for onward travel. Taxis conveniently line up outside the ticket hall entrance for quick transitions, and nearby bus services operate efficiently to ensure your journey doesn’t miss a beat.
